Pokémon makes its mark on retail shelves across India.

As a part of the Spring Summer Pokémon collection, more than 250 products will be available across stores Pokémon products will be available across stores in India and all leading online market places. The range boasts of Back-to-School which includes School Bags, Pencil Cases, Lunch Boxes, and Stationery. It also has a cool collection cross Kids Apparel, Swing Scooters and a line of Camlin’s Pokémon Products comprising sketch pens, mechanical pencils and oil pastels.

In addition, grown up fans of Pokémon can lay their hands on some really cool Pokémon phone covers very soon!

With its second innings on Hungama TV started in May 2014, Pokémon has become talk of the town not only on screen, but also on retail shelves. As a part of the retail strategy, we have coined a successful licensing strategy where Pokémon’s Indian licensees have launched a wide range of products and collections for Spring Summer 2016.

Pokémon consumer products program ramps up: Dream Theatre

Pokémon is a popular international brand with a slew of TV serials, movies, video games, toys and consumer products. The show is syndicated by Dream Theatre to Hungama TV, marking the former’s foray in the content syndication space adding to an already-existing licensing and merchandising business in India and South Asia. .

Dream Theatre helped re-launched this brand in India and South Asia in not only Syndication but also Licensing and Merchandising. This global entertainment brand is ramping up for continued success following the launch of licensed Pokémon products.
Dream Theatre has kicked-in the second phase of making the merchandise available for its fans. Having partnered with Hungama TV, the TV show continues to be amongst the top rated kid’s animation content on television.

The number of licensees for Pokémon is growing slowly and we are assertive about the program getting accelerated by the end of this year.

A historical moment in Indian Kids TV

Pokémon on both Disney and Cartoon Network! It’s not often that you find two of the competitor kids networks: Disney Networks with Hungama and Turner Broadcasting with Cartoon Network backing the same show!

Pokémon is back, bigger and better than ever! Pokémon Season 1, 2 and 3 play out on Hungama and has been a super hit right from its launch. The average rating recorded for this show continues to be over 1 TVR. Reaching out to a 57.1-million-strong audience across India, of which 24.2 million are kids, the show has ranked consistently. With Season 3, Hungama has added another slot of 9.00 pm to Pokémon prime play slots.

Cartoon Network has countered this by pulling out some of the Pokémon content of Season 14 and placing the same on their network. Pokémon Black & White runs on Cartoon Network. Daily Monday to Friday at 12:30pm and 8pm!
